View Single Post
First, what are sneaky peeks?
Sneaky peeks are our latest (unstable) internal builds. These internal builds are exactly what we see here at Omni: they're just snapshots of our development that are updated every few hours and haven't gone through any sort of vetting process—which means that you might actually be the first person to try a particular build and discover that it eats your system. (We hope that doesn't happen, of course—it would be pretty upsetting if a build were to eat any of our files when we run it—but since we won't have tested the app before giving you access we can't make any guarantees.)

In other words, sneaky peeks aren't for the faint of heart; they're an invitation to come join us on the bleeding edge of our development process.
Now that that's out of the way, what's new in OmniFocus 1.8?
OmniFocus 1.8 for Mac improves task workflow by including projects, groups, and inbox items in Context lists, Due lists, and Flagged lists. This prevents these items from slipping through the cracks, and makes it easier to check them off when they're complete.
Workflow Improvements
Groups, Projects, and Inbox items now show up in Context lists, Due lists, and Flagged lists. When actions are sorted by project, parent items follow their children (which is the natural order for completing them). Single Action Lists are not actionable, and do not appear in Context lists.

Groups are now considered actionable. They can block other actions in a sequence, and are eligible to become the first "next action" for a project. Groups are blocked by their children.

We've reorganized the filtering options in the View Bar, separating the Availability Filter from the Status Filter and adding some new options. For example, you can now choose to show all Remaining items which are either Due or Flagged—or only those Due or Flagged items which are currently Available.

Context mode can now display all actions at once: you no longer have to choose between showing Remaining or Completed actions. (This is great for viewing a list of all items by date modified, for example.)
Synchronization
  • Sync Preferences now has an option to publish an OmniFocus Reminders calendar for due task notifications.
  • Sync settings sent through email are now compatible with iPhone OS 3.0 and later. (In iPhone OS 3.0, iPhone Mail stopped recognizing dashes in URL schemes, so we've switched to using omnifocus:///setup-sync?url=...)
  • Edits in progress should no longer get lost when changes are synchronized from another computer.
  • Fixed a bug where syncing a change to an action's start date wouldn't always change its context's count of available actions.
  • Fixed a bug which could cause duplication of a repeating due project or group during synchronization.
  • Improved sync compatibility with some Windows WebDAV servers.

Attachment List
  • The Attachment List now sorts its attachments when it first appears (rather than only sorting when you click on a column header).
  • The Attachment List now obeys your date format settings from System Preferences.
  • When the Attachment List is visible, it no longer shows up twice in the Window menu.
  • Fixed a crash seen when double-clicking on a perspective icon attachment in the Attachment List.
  • Fixed a crash encountered on 10.4 when clicking on the column headers in the Attachment List.
  • Fixed a crash encountered when deleting large numbers of attachments at once.
  • The Attachment List will no longer refuse to delete attachments which it can't find in the container's notes.
  • The Attachment List is much faster at handling long lists of attachments.

Miscellaneous
  • Added support for omnifocus:///add URLs for adding items via Quick Entry (as introduced in OmniFocus 1.6 for iPhone).
  • Added support for changing synchronized settings through settings links like this:
    omnifocus:///change-setting?DefaultDueTime=22:00
  • Updated the built-in help.
  • Updated the iDisk icon in Sync Preferences.
  • Updated the flag in a number of icons.
  • Fixed a bug where Due Soon items wouldn't always update on schedule.
  • When a project is on hold or otherwise inactive, its actions are no longer considered to be available.
  • Project mode can now display the Project column. (The current project is implied by the project hierarchy, but a separate column can be useful when reviewing a project and reassigning actions to different projects.)
  • Duplicating a project from the sidebar no longer skips completed items in that project. (This matches the behavior of duplicating a project in the main outline.)
  • The "No Context" sidebar item no longer counts items which are assigned to dropped contexts.
  • Fixed some regressions with the application unhiding while using Quick Entry.
  • Fixed a bug where OmniFocus could incorrectly indicate you were in a perspective when opening a related window (e.g. double-clicking on an action in the Due perspective would claim that the new window was also in the Due perspective).
  • Checking for updates will no longer trigger an "invalid display" message to the Console.
  • Spotlight searches support searching for completed actions.
  • The gear button in the column header area is no longer stretched and blurry, and its border line now lines up with the scroller line below it.
  • Fixed a crash sometimes encountered when double-clicking on Library in a focused window.

You can download the latest build-of-the-day from the OmniFocus sneaky peek download page.

We look forward to your feedback!

Last edited by Ken Case; 2010-02-17 at 12:09 AM.. Reason: highlighted workflow changes